Bennett Family

Hudson Bennett was born on June 5, 1807 in the Fairfax area.  Hudson married Lucy Bennett he moved to Dranesville where he lived as a farmer.  Their marriage produced at least five children who all attended school. He was a slave owner before the Civil War.  In 1850 he owned three slaves: one 25 year old black female, one 16 year old black male, and one 5 year old black female.  In 1860 he owned five slaves: one 36 year old black female, one 17 year old black female, one 8 year old black male, one 5 year old black female, and one two year old black female.  There was no mention of what happened to his slaves after the war ended.   Hudson died on July 26, 1892.

Lucy A Bennett was born on June 18, 1812.  She kept house for the family until her death on March 13, 1887.
